Hi All,

I am an investor in PA that owns a Pre-Manufactured Home. I have a seller that is interested in the home but would like to do Owner Financing. I am into the home for 14 K. The selling price is 20K. The land rent is 650/month. Total taxes are 1,700. 

 This is the first time considering this option. Is there any specific terms or numbers I should look for? How many years? What amount for the down payment? etc? 

Thank you in advance.

I would suggest that simply trying to "look into both of those rulings" will do little for you. First of all, they are both public acts - not rulings. Second the Dodd Frank Act is over 2300 pages long, and there are another 12,000 pages of secondary legislation attached to it. 

You also need to be cognizant of Pennsylvania regulations as well. You will find there is no legal method for lease with an option to purchase lending arrangement a manufactured home in that state.
